Temperature range in Indiana

Indiana has temperatures ranging from -12°F to 93°F, with approximately 174 frost free days.

Indiana has 157 days with average temperature range from 50°F to 90°F that are suitable for growing warm season vegetables and 127 days with average temperature range from 40°F to 80°F that are suitable for growing cool season vegetables

Warm season vegetables you can grow in Indiana

Chart displaying days suitable for growing warm season vegetables in Indiana

Days suitable for growing warm season vegetables in Indiana

Warm season vegetables can be planted in Indiana after May 15 when air temperatures are consistently above 50°F (10°C) and soil temperature is above 50°F (10°C)

Good temperature range for warm season vegetables is between 50°F and 90°F. With warm season vegetables it is important to wait until all conditions are optimal, because sudden temperature drop can stun new vegetable growth, this way delaying overall harvest.

Cool season vegetables you can grow in Indiana

Chart displaying days suitable for growing cool season vegetables in Indiana

Days suitable for growing cool season vegetables in Indiana

Cool season vegetables can be planted in Indiana after April 22 when average air temperature is consistently above 40°F (4°C) and soil temperature is above 45°F (7°C)

Good temperature range for cool season vegetables is between 40°F and 80°F. With cool season vegetables it is important to avoid high air temperatures because exposure to high temperatures is most likely to stun growth, cause bitterness and encourage premature bolting in some plants. Plan your cool vegetable planting so they are harvested before hot weather stretch, provide them with additional shading.
